You Can Be the First on Your Block to Own a 3D TV

At least three major players in the consumer electronics business are expected to roll out mass-marketed versions of 3D television within the next few months.

Start saving your movie money. Building off the momentum of “Avatar” and “Alice in Wonderland,” big-screen movies with eye-popping special effects, Sony, Samsung and Panasonic are posturing for market dominance on a household scale. An electronics research firm estimates 1.2 million 3D TVs will be sold globally this year, exploding to 15.6 million units just three years from now (2013).

Depending on who you talk to (and considering the source), this might be the greatest thing to hit the home entertainment industry since the world converted from black and white to color television sets.
